Web service com.senior.g5.rh.sm.FichaMedica
Tipo de execução
Para cada tipo de execução, existem diferentes parâmetros que podem ser comuns a todas as portas.
Autenticação
Caso seja utilizada alguma forma de autenticação para integração de informações através de web services, é necessário identificado o tipo no parâmetro <encryption>, conforme seus valores possíveis.
WSDL
- Síncrono: http://example.com/g5-senior-services/sm_Synccom_senior_g5_rh_sm_FichaMedica?wsdl
- Assíncrono: http://example.com/g5-senior-services/sm_Asynccom_senior_g5_rh_sm_FichaMedica?wsdl
- Agendado: http://example.com/g5-senior-services/sm_Scheduledcom_senior_g5_rh_sm_FichaMedica?wsdl
Porta
FichaMedica
Neste Web service é possível cadastrar, alterar e excluir registros de ficha médica.
Necessita autenticação: Sim
Situação de versão: Atual
Versão: 1
Requisição:
<so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/" xmlns:ser="http://services.senior.com.br"> <soapenv:Body> <ser:FichaMedica> <user>String</user> <password>String</password> <encryption>Integer</encryption> <parameters> <tipOpe>String</tipOpe> <numEmp>Integer</numEmp> <codFic>Integer</codFic> <tipAtn>Integer</tipAtn> <tipCol>Integer</tipCol> <numCad>Integer</numCad> <codDep>Integer</codDep> <numCan>Integer</numCan> <nomAtn>String</nomAtn> <gruSan>String</gruSan> <pesAtn>Double</pesAtn> <altAtn>Double</altAtn> <tipFis>String</tipFis> <defFis>String</defFis> <codDef>Integer</codDef> <benRea>String</benRea> <colDoa>String</colDoa> <ultDoa>String</ultDoa> </parameters> </ser:FichaMedica> </soapenv:Body> </soapenv:Envelope>
Parâmetros da requisição:
Nome | Preenchimento | Tipo | Descrição |
---|---|---|---|
tipOpe | Obrigatório | String | Tipo da operação a ser efetuada na integração.
Valores: "I" - Inclusão "A" - Alteração "E" - Exclusão |
numEmp | Obrigatório | Integer | Código da empresa que será utilizada na integração.
- Campo Chave - Máscara: 9999 |
codFic | Obrigatório | Integer | Informar o código da ficha médica.
- Máscara: zzzzzzzz9 |
tipAtn | Opcional | Integer | Informar o tipo atendido.
- Máscara: 9[1] |
tipCol | Opcional | Integer | Informar o tipo do colaborador
- Máscara: 9[1] |
numCad | Opcional | Integer | Informar o cadastro do colaborador
- Máscara: 9[9] |
codDep | Opcional | Integer | Informar o código do dependete atendido
- Máscara: 9[2] |
numCan | Opcional | Integer | Informar o cadastro do candidato atendido
- Máscara: 9[7] |
nomAtn | Opcional | String | Informar o nome do atendido
- Máscara: A[40] |
gruSan | Opcional | String | Informar o grupo sanguíneo
- Máscara: U[3] |
pesAtn | Opcional | Double | Informar o peso do atendido
- Máscara: zz9,99 |
altAtn | Opcional | Double | Informar a altura do atendido
- Máscara: zz9,99 |
tipFis | Opcional | String | Informar o tipo físico
- Máscara: U[1] |
defFis | Opcional | String | Informar se o deficiente é habilitado ou reabilitado
- Máscara: U[1] |
codDef | Opcional | Integer | Informar o código da deficiência
- Máscara: 9[2] |
benRea | Opcional | String | Informar se o beneficiário é reabilitado
- Máscara: U[1] |
colDoa | Opcional | String | Identificar se a pessoa édoadora de sangue
- Máscara: U[1] |
ultDoa | Opcional | DateTime | Informar a data da última doação
- Máscara: DD/MM/YYYY |
Resposta:
Observação
Envelope SOAP de resposta de requisições síncronas. Para requisições assíncronas ou agendamentos, a resposta é apenas uma String chamada "result" com o valor "OK", se foi executado com sucesso ou, caso contrário, a mensagem do erro ocorrido.
<so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/" xmlns:ser="http://services.senior.com.br">
<soapenv:Body>
<ser:FichaMedicaResponse>
<result>
<erroExecucao>String</erroExecucao>
</result>
</ser:FichaMedicaResponse>
</soapenv:Body>
</soapenv:Envelope>
Atributos da resposta:
Nome | Preenchimento | Tipo | Descrição |
---|---|---|---|
erroExecucao | Opcional | String |
Indica erros ocorridos no servidor ao executar o serviço, podendo conter os seguintes valores:
- Vazio ou nulo, indicando que a execução foi feita com sucesso; - A mensagem do erro ocorrido no servidor. |